The value of 1 COOP share will be 11 times the price of 1 RKT share. (Then, the $2 bonus.)
And, no, the price of COOP doesn't matter. (But it will likely be pretty close to that amount.)
This agreement is why the increased price of COOP between the date of the announcement and the finalization date doesn't matter to RKT in the end. As the companies announced, this is an all-shares acquisition, so RKT is giving 11 of their shares for each COOP share, regardless of the price. It doesn't cost RKT any cash, but we get the increased amount in value.
